Voltaire and others have argued against censorship. Is censorship ever acceptable? Explain your answer.

History
1 answer:
Pani-rosa [81]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Censorship is never acceptable.

Explanation:

Censorship quiets down the opinion/beliefs of someone who may have an idea/plan worth talking about. Historically, censored people usually try to inform others of the evils around, but are censored(threatened and/or killed).
